CloudCity VR, released in 2017, is an indie simulator that allows players to construct and manage their own city in a virtual reality setting. This game combines strategy with immersive gameplay, where you can oversee the growth of your metropolis while ensuring the happiness of its citizens. With its full day/night cycle and dynamic weather, CloudCity VR offers a unique perspective on city-building, letting players experience their creations from both first-person and towering viewpoints.
